  5. Constructor with interface arguments in Java Class Diagrams

    Sep 19, 2021 · @AMS The «create» is a keyword to identify a constructor: “A constructor is an operation having a single return result parameter of the type of the owning class, and marked with the standard stereotoe «create»” (UML 2.5 specifications, page 193). In UML the constructor does not have to have the name of the class.

  7. Class diagrams - Java Programming

    In a class diagram, we list all class methods including the constructors; constructors are listed first and then all class methods. We also write the return type of a method in the class diagram. A class diagram describes classes and their attributes, constructors and methods as well as the connections between classes.
